What is a process engineer?

Process Engineers are professionals who design, implement, and optimize industrial processes to improve efficiency, quality, and safety in manufacturing or production environments. They analyze workflows, troubleshoot process issues, and develop solutions to enhance productivity and reduce costs. Process Engineers often work in industries such as chemicals, pharmaceuticals, food and beverage, and energy, ensuring processes are compliant with environmental and safety regulations. Their work is vital for maintaining smooth operations and achieving organizational goals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a process eng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Process Engineer, you need a solid background in chemical, mechanical, or industrial engineering, often supported by a relevant bachelor's degree and understanding of process optimization principles. Familiarity with process simulation software (such as Aspen Plus or AutoCAD), Six Sigma methodologies, and quality management systems is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ills set candidates apart in this role. These skills and qualifications are essential to improve efficiency, ensure safety, and drive continuous improvement in industrial and manufacturing processes.

What are some common challenges process engineers face when implementing process improvements, and how can they overcome them?

Process Engineers often encounter challenges such as resistance to change from team members, integrating new technologies with existing systems, and ensuring process changes meet regulatory standards. Overcoming these obstacles typically involves clear communication, involving stakeholders early in the process, thorough documentation, and piloting changes before full-scale implementation. Building strong cross-functional relationships and continuously gathering feedback also help ensure that improvements are effective and sustainable.

What is the difference between Process Engineer vs Manufacturing Engineer?

AspectProcess EngineerManufacturing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's in Engineering, certifications like Six SigmaBachelor's in Engineering, certifications like Lean Manufacturing
Work EnvironmentDesigning and optimizing processes, R&D settingsOverseeing production lines, factory floors
Industry UsageManufacturing, chemical, aerospaceAutomotive, electronics, consumer goods

Process Engineers focus on designing and improving manufacturing processes, often working in R&D or engineering departments. Manufacturing Engineers concentrate on implementing and managing production on the factory floor. Both roles require similar technical skills and certifications but differ mainly in their scope and work environment.

Job description

This position will be responsible for taking an assigned projects/tasks and following them through to completion. The primary focus supporting existing product.   This will require the individual to work with various departments and groups to develop a strategic plan to achieve the desired results. This person should be goal oriented and a self-starter with technical aptitude. They must also possess good computer and communication skills.   
  • This position will be responsible for specific reman product development to achieve CNH Reman SBP
  • Key driver of production safety, quality and efficiency
  • Manage expense tracking and work orders for related accounts
  • Participate in and support Open Book Management
  • Assist and maintain adherence to project timelines
  • Work within budgets using a balance of creativity and capital
Essential Responsibilities:
  • Participate in Advanced Product Quality Planning (APQP) program (prepare new product lines for release to production, assist in the transfer of products for R&D to the production department) Comply with ISO Quality standards and requirements
  • Develop work instructions for reman products
  • Develop reports for management, customers and maintain accurate filing system for all product development records
  • Create item masters in ERP system (manage part number revisions and upgrades)
  • Study core units and analyze component wear to estimate extent of remanufacturing required
  • Create and structure Bills of Material (BOMs)
  • Set replacement percentages for new BOMs (determine scrap levels of remanufactured products, new product or process documentation)
  • Work with production department to determine labor times.  Work with sales department on quoting process
  • Work with Manufacturing Engineering regarding capital and tooling for product lines
  • Support the development of process flow charts, PFEMA’s, control plans, and work processes
  • Create build documentation (i.e. responsibility sheets, dock audit sheets, serial number log sheets, exploded views with part numbers, etc.)
  • Handle Process Change Requests (PCRs), Document Change Notices (DCNs), & BOM change requests
  • Work with Quality to obtain customer approval of PPAP.  Work closely with other departments to help solve issues
  • Interface with Material Control, Purchasing, Sales, Production, Accounting, and Suppliers to produce cost effective and manufacturable products.
  • Provides customer support in the form of drawing files, troubleshooting and application assistance as assigned.
  • Participate on project teams and on short term assignments.  Perform other duties assigned by the supervisor and Product Engineering Manager.
  • Participate in and support the principles of Open Book Management and recognize the responsibilities of being a part owner of the company.
